trip description for Full Day Walleye Hunt in Lakeside Marblehead

If you've been searching for the Walleye trip of a lifetime, look no further. Captain Chris is an expert when it comes to fishing Lake Erie for these gamefish, and he'll make sure that you and yours have a blast and go home with a trophy, a full cooler, or both! In order to maximize the chances of success, Captain Chris follows the fish as they migrate around the lake. In the spring, you'll fish the western basin, then move east as the water begins to warm up. In the fall, the fish head back west and eat like crazy as they prepare for the long winter. If you're looking to catch a trophy, spring and fall are the times to do it! On this trip, you'll be using a variety of lures to draw bites. Depending on the time of year, there are a several different techniques to choose from. In the spring, you'll employ diving crank baits that can find Walleye down in the deep, cold water. Towards the middle of the summer, you'll focus on trolling. As the season progresses, you may switch to spoons or other lures depending on what's getting the bite. Captain Chris will make sure to get you set up with the best tackle, no matter the season! You'll be fishing out there aboard his 20' Fishmaster built in 2017. She's a fast boat that's ideal for trolling, with twin 225-HP Mercury outboards so you'll be out there in the blink of an eye! You'll be provided with everything you need for a blue-ribbon fishing trip; all you need to bring is proper clothing for the weather, your Ohio fishing license, and a good attitude! Read More

What types of fishing trips are common in Lakeside Marblehead?

Lake fishing is the most popular in Lakeside Marblehead as well as river fishing and nearshore fishing.

The most commonly sought after species in Lakeside Marblehead are: 1. walleye, 2. perch, 3. channel catfish, and 4. smallmouth bass.

The most common fishing techniques in Lakeside Marblehead are light tackle fishing, artificial lure fishing, and trolling but drift fishing and bottom fishing are popular as well.

What is fishing in Lakeside Marblehead?

Fishing in Lakeside Marblehead, Ohio, offers anglers a diverse array of opportunities along the shores of Lake Erie and nearby inland waterways. Situated in the heart of the Lake Erie Shores and Islands region, Lakeside Marblehead provides easy access to prime fishing grounds teeming with a variety of freshwater species. Whether casting from the shoreline, wading in the shallows, or launching a boat into the open waters, anglers can target sought-after catches such as walleye, yellow perch, smallmouth bass, and steelhead trout, making it a popular destination for fishing enthusiasts of all levels.

Spring and summer are particularly productive seasons for fishing in Lakeside Marblehead, as warmer temperatures draw fish closer to the shoreline in search of food and spawning grounds. Anglers can capitalize on this abundance by trolling nearshore waters, casting from the pier, or venturing out onto Lake Erie in search of larger catches. Additionally, the fall season brings the annual migration of steelhead trout, offering exciting opportunities for anglers to test their skills against these powerful and acrobatic fish as they make their way upstream from Lake Erie's tributaries.

Beyond the waters of Lake Erie, anglers can explore nearby inland waterways like the Sandusky Bay and nearby rivers and streams. These inland waters offer opportunities for targeting a variety of freshwater species, including walleye, bass, panfish, and catfish. Whether fishing from the shore, a kayak, or a small boat, anglers can enjoy a peaceful and scenic angling experience while surrounded by the natural beauty of the surrounding landscape. With its abundance of fishing opportunities and scenic beauty, Lakeside Marblehead provides anglers with memorable experiences and plentiful opportunities to reel in a prized catch.

What are the most popular months to fish in Lakeside Marblehead?

Fishing seasons in Lakeside Marblehead, Ohio, follow a familiar pattern dictated by the changing seasons and the behavior of freshwater fish in Lake Erie and its surrounding waters. Spring marks the beginning of the fishing season, as warming temperatures awaken the lake's waters and trigger the annual spawning migrations of various fish species. Anglers eagerly anticipate the arrival of walleye, yellow perch, and smallmouth bass, which move closer to the shoreline in search of spawning grounds. Springtime fishing in Lakeside Marblehead offers opportunities for both shore fishing and boat angling, with anglers employing a variety of techniques to target these early-season catches.

As summer unfolds, fishing in Lakeside Marblehead reaches its peak, with abundant opportunities for anglers to reel in a variety of freshwater species. Warm waters bring an influx of baitfish, attracting larger predatory fish like walleye and bass to the nearshore areas. Anglers can enjoy productive fishing sessions throughout the summer months, whether casting from the pier, trolling the open waters, or fly fishing in the nearby rivers and streams. The longer days and milder weather of summer make it an ideal time for anglers to spend extended hours on the water, soaking in the natural beauty of Lake Erie's scenic shoreline while pursuing their favorite catches.

Autumn brings a change of pace to fishing in Lakeside Marblehead, as cooler temperatures signal the transition to fall fishing. While some species begin to migrate away from the shoreline in preparation for winter, others, like steelhead trout, begin their annual upstream journey from Lake Erie's tributaries. Anglers can capitalize on this migration by targeting steelhead in the rivers and streams that feed into the lake, offering a different angling experience amidst the vibrant colors of fall foliage. With each season offering its own unique fishing opportunities, Lakeside Marblehead provides anglers with year-round excitement and adventure on the waters of Lake Erie and its surrounding waterways.

What types of fishing are popular in Lakeside Marblehead?

In Lakeside Marblehead, Ohio, anglers have the opportunity to engage in various types of fishing, each offering its own unique challenges and rewards. One popular method is shore fishing, allowing anglers to cast their lines from the comfort of solid ground along the shores of Lake Erie or its nearby tributaries. From the rocky beaches to the piers and breakwalls, shore anglers can target a variety of freshwater species, including walleye, yellow perch, smallmouth bass, and steelhead trout. Shore fishing provides accessibility and convenience, making it a favorite choice for anglers of all ages and skill levels.

Boat fishing is another favored approach, providing anglers with the freedom to explore deeper waters and access prime fishing spots beyond the reach of shore anglers. Anglers can launch their boats from Lakeside Marblehead's marinas and venture out onto Lake Erie to target larger catches like walleye, bass, and steelhead trout. Whether trolling along the shoreline, drifting over underwater structures, or venturing out to the open waters, boat fishing in Lakeside Marblehead offers anglers the opportunity to cover more water and increase their chances of landing a prized catch.

Fly fishing enthusiasts will find plenty to love in Lakeside Marblehead, particularly in the nearby rivers and streams like the Sandusky River and East Harbor State Park. These inland waterways provide a serene and picturesque backdrop for fly fishing adventures, where anglers can target species like steelhead trout, bass, and panfish. Whether wading in the cool waters of the river or casting from the banks, fly fishing in Lakeside Marblehead offers a peaceful and immersive angling experience for those who appreciate the artistry and precision of this time-honored technique.

What species are popular in Lakeside Marblehead?

In Lakeside Marblehead, Ohio, anglers have the opportunity to target a variety of freshwater species, making it a prime destination for fishing enthusiasts. One of the most prized catches in the region is the walleye, known for its delicious taste and challenging fight. Walleye are abundant in the waters of Lake Erie, particularly during the spring and summer months when they migrate closer to the shoreline in search of spawning grounds. Anglers can employ a variety of techniques, such as trolling with diving plugs or casting with jigs, to entice these elusive fish and reel in a satisfying catch.

Yellow perch are another sought-after species among anglers in Lakeside Marblehead. These tasty panfish can be found in abundance along the shoreline and near underwater structures, especially during the warmer months when they gather in large schools. Anglers can target yellow perch using a variety of bait and tackle, including minnows, worms, and small jigs, making them an accessible and enjoyable catch for anglers of all skill levels.

Steelhead trout provide anglers with an exciting angling opportunity in Lakeside Marblehead, particularly during the fall and winter months. These powerful and acrobatic fish migrate upstream from Lake Erie's tributaries each year, offering anglers the chance to test their skills against their impressive strength and agility. Anglers can target steelhead using a variety of techniques, including drift fishing with spawn sacks, casting with spoons or spinners, and fly fishing with nymphs or streamers. With their tenacious fight and striking appearance, steelhead trout provide anglers with a thrilling fishing experience amidst the scenic beauty of Lakeside Marblehead's waterways.

What are the best places to fish in Lakeside Marblehead?

When it comes to finding the best places to fish in Lakeside Marblehead, Ohio, anglers are spoiled for choice with a variety of prime fishing spots along the shores of Lake Erie and its surrounding waters. One popular destination is the Lakeside Marblehead Lighthouse State Park, which offers anglers scenic views and ample opportunities to cast their lines into the open waters of the lake. From the rocky shoreline to the nearby breakwalls and piers, anglers can target a variety of freshwater species, including walleye, yellow perch, bass, and steelhead trout. With its panoramic views of Lake Erie and productive fishing grounds, Lakeside Marblehead Lighthouse State Park is a favorite among local anglers and visitors alike.

Another top spot for fishing in Lakeside Marblehead is the East Harbor State Park, which provides anglers with access to both Lake Erie and the inland waters of East Harbor. Anglers can launch their boats from the park's marina and venture out onto the lake to target larger catches like walleye, bass, and steelhead trout. Additionally, the park offers opportunities for shore fishing along its scenic shoreline and nearby tributaries, allowing anglers to explore a variety of fishing environments within a single location.

For those looking to explore inland waterways, the nearby Sandusky Bay provides excellent fishing opportunities for a variety of freshwater species. Anglers can cast their lines from the shoreline or launch a kayak or small boat to explore the bay's productive fishing grounds. From targeting bass and panfish in the shallows to pursuing walleye and catfish in deeper waters, Sandusky Bay offers anglers a diverse range of fishing experiences against the backdrop of its tranquil waters and picturesque surroundings.

Other things to do in Lakeside Marblehead

Beyond fishing, Lakeside Marblehead, Ohio, offers a range of activities and attractions to enjoy for visitors of all interests. History enthusiasts can explore the rich maritime heritage of the region by visiting attractions like the Marblehead Lighthouse, Ohio's oldest operating lighthouse. Perched on the shores of Lake Erie, the lighthouse offers guided tours and panoramic views of the surrounding waters, providing insight into the area's maritime history and serving as a picturesque backdrop for memorable photos.

Outdoor enthusiasts can take advantage of Lakeside Marblehead's natural beauty by exploring the nearby East Harbor State Park. The park boasts scenic hiking trails, sandy beaches, and tranquil picnic areas, making it the perfect spot for a day of outdoor recreation. Visitors can enjoy activities such as swimming, boating, kayaking, and birdwatching amidst the park's diverse landscapes, providing opportunities to reconnect with nature and soak in the fresh air and sunshine.

For those interested in local culture and arts, Lakeside Marblehead offers opportunities to explore the vibrant arts scene of the region. Visitors can browse local galleries and artisan shops, showcasing the work of talented artists and craftsmen from the area. Additionally, Lakeside Marblehead hosts a variety of community events and festivals throughout the year, featuring live music, food vendors, and family-friendly activities that celebrate the unique culture and heritage of the region. Whether exploring the area's history, enjoying outdoor recreation, or immersing oneself in the local arts scene, Lakeside Marblehead offers something for everyone to enjoy beyond the waters of Lake Erie.
